The Black and Decker 3/8" 7190 is the best all around drill I have ever used. It's 0-1200 rpms is high enough to drill holes fast in metal or wood, yet low enough to be controlled for putting in screws. By adjusting the trigger button to the right speed, you can work all day without stripping out sheetmetal or breaking the screw in metal or wood. It's the perfect tool for putting on metal roofing where the screw has to be snug without rolling the neoprene washer. It's lightweight, economical, and never runs out of power. You will need a heavier drill for drilling large holes, or putting 3 1/2 " decking screws in hard wood. The engineers at Black and Decker did it right when they designed this drill. It's the best that was ever built and it hasn't been improved on.
